Characterization and preparation of ultra-fine grained WC–Co alloys with minor La-additions
چکیده انگلیسی

The ultra-fine grained WC–Co alloys with different lanthanum contents were prepared through sol–gel process and low pressure sintering. Effects of lanthanum on the microstructure and mechanical properties of WC–Co alloys were investigated using X-ray diffraction, scanning electron microscopy and mechanical testing. The results showed that trace La addition suppresses the formation of binder-enrichment structure on the sintered skin, decreases the WC grain size and the volume fraction of Co3W3C phase, and thus greatly improves the hardness and fracture toughness of the ultra-fine grained WC–Co cemented carbides.


► The authors first reported the ultra-fine grained WC–Co alloys with different lanthanum contents prepared through sol–gel process and low pressure sintering.
► Trace lanthanum addition suppresses the formation of binder-enrichment structure on the sintered skin and decreases the WC grain size and the volume fraction of Co3W3C phase.
► Trace lanthanum addition improves the hardness and fracture toughness of the ultra-fine grained WC–Co cemented carbides.
